    Panny 65VT30 Screen Power Cycle Issue

    New to the forums here and searched for an answer extensively before posting.

    I have a 2011 Panny 65VT30 and it has run flawlessly for 5 years. The other day it started to click and what seemed to be a power cycle and then came back on. During this time I heard the typical 'clicking' noises that it does when it turns off and on.

    This happens when the TV has been on for an extended period, i.e. over 3 hours.It will cycle and then it might not happen for another 20 minutes.

    I know many have reported the 7,8 & 10 red light blinking issue. However, the light does not blink on mine.

    Any thoughts?

            If you are told you can not access this server it is because you are not located in the USA. If your IP address is not within the USA they won't allow you to access the website. They only service within the USA and I think Canada as well.
            Lastly, take a look at the back side of your SS board and more specifically the large capacitors on it. I just had that model come into the shop a few weeks ago with similar problem, and all those caps had cracked solder joints. To be honest, you should probably flip over your SC and power supply board as well and check all three for cracked solder joints just to be safe.
